Major news behind the scenes in AEW, as Kevin Sullivan, the Vice President of Post Production was let go today. Mike Mansury, the Senior Vice President and Co-Executive Producer made the call. Sullivan, no relation to the more famous wrestler, was very highly thought of and had been with AEW from the earliest days, coming over from Impact. Sullivan built the entire AEW post production team that was based in Nashville so there are a lot of questions going around regarding what happened past the feeling that the original AEW has changed greatly.

Raw tonight from Albany, NY has Seth Rollins vs. Jey Uso for the World title, Johnny Gargano & Tommaso Ciampa vs. Ludvig Kaiser & Giovanni Vinci in a 2/3 fall match, Drew McIntyre vs. Sami Zayn, Nia Jax vs. Shayna Baszler, The Creeds vs. Dominik Mysterio & JD McDonagh, Natalya & Tegan Nox vs. Kayden Carter & Katana Chance plus Cody Rhodes will talk about Shinsuke Nakamura. The NFL game tonight head-to-head are the Cincinnati Bengals vs. Jacksonville Jaguars. There were about 6,800 tickets out earlier today and they had moved 1,700 in the last week from fans expecting Randy Orton and C.M. Punk. Neither are advertised for tonight nor were advertised locally, but I would expect most fans expect at least Punk on the show as Orton was made pretty clear is on Smackdown.
Dana White has been teasing the idea of a dream match in April for UFC 300. This has led to talk of Ronda Rouesy vs. Miesha Tate going around, although everything we've heard from the Rousey side is that she is not interested in fighting again and was looking to have another child. White had in the past always shot down any rumors of Rousey returning, which naturally started when her WWE contract expired and she left full-time pro wrestling.

Rampage and Collision on Friday and Saturday night both air on TSN 2 in Canada. Usually those shows only air on the TSN app, but because they are being taped in Montreal, they will air in Canada.
The Collision show for Saturday is being taped tomorrow night in Montreal at the Bell Center with Eddie Kingston vs. Claudio Castagnoli and Bryan Danielson vs. Andrade.

The NWA announced that JCP Southeast will be its second official territory. Joe Cazana Promotions is the parent company of NWA JCP Southeast. Joe Cazana is the grandson of John Cazna, who promoted out of Knoxville dating back to 1953 and worked with Ron Fuller's Southeastern Championships Wrestling in the 70s and 80s, Thrillbilly Silas Mason will now be a double NWA champion, holding the National heavyweight title and the Southeastern title.
